ANDROID: Avoid taking multiple locks in handle_lmk_event



Conflicting lock events have been reported resulting from
rcu_read_lock, mmap_sem (in get_cmdline) and lmk_event_lock.

This CL avoids the possibility of these conditions by moving
handle_lmk_event outside rcu_read_lock and invoking get_cmdline before
lmk_event_lock is taken.
